--- Begin Message --- Subject: update python-setuptools-scm to 7.0.5 Date: Fri, 23 Dec 2022 15:50:31 +0100
Hi!

I've seen another attempt to update setuptools-scm to 7.0.5 that
disabled sanity-check for it.

Here's an alternative series of patches not needing to disable
sanity-checks, but requiring to move another small (0.2 MiB, no
dependency outside python-build) package to the python-build module,
python-typing-extensions.

This has been tested (not extensively, but Guix compiles and build all
packages I need in my personal configuration).
